CIMI Science Camp

Camp Dates

6th Grade Science Camp at Catalina Island Marine Institute (CIMI) is scheduled for June 5 - 7, 2013!

Important Preparation Dates - 2013

  • CIMI Reservation & Deposit: Friday, March 15 to Julie Bassine in Main Office - See Parent Letter 
  • CIMI Trip Fundraiser Starts: Monday, March 25
  • CIMI Trip Fundraiser Ends: Wednesday, April 10
  • Final payment due:  Wednesday, May 1
  • Parent Meeting:  Tuesday, May 14 at 6pm in Adams Gym

Who is eligible to participate in CIMI?

Sixth Graders are eligible to participate in CIMI.  Eligibility is based on grades, behavior, and attendance.  If your student does not earn a min. of 2.0 GPA at the end of the third quarter progress report card or has had any discipline incidents they will not be allowed to attend CIMI.

Space is limited, so reservation are accepted on a first-come basis.  A parent letter is sent home usually in February with a tear-off section indicating interest.  Filling out this form and returning it to the Adams Office by March 15 with a deposit of $40 holds a spot for your child.

How much does CIMI Cost?

The cost to attend CIMI is $260 per student.  (The cost varies by year, so please refer to the Parent Letter for the exact cost.)  There will be a fundraising opportunity for those who either need financial assistance or prefer their students to "earn" their way to camp.

Need Medications??

If your student takes ANY over the counter OR prescribed medications, you must have the form (RBUSD-Request for Assistance with Medication During Regular School Day) filled out & signed by you AND a doctor.  This includes something as simple as using Dramamine for sea sickness to an inhaler at night for asthma.  Please review the Adams Health Office Policies For Camps and return the filled out forms to the Parent Meeting on Tuesday, May 14, 2013.
